Output 6649446d3c6156627c8513c4c31d585ff99486cf602bf8c236059c7b75ffe723:16
- value
- 27889980
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f8583fc6bb246a9827a6404275208bf57a6cc486f7e7548333e9f07cf45a056e
- address
- tb1plpvrl34my34fsfaxgpp82gyt74axe3yx7ln4fqena8c8eaz6q4hqc9xgm7
- transaction
- 6649446d3c6156627c8513c4c31d585ff99486cf602bf8c236059c7b75ffe723
- confirmations
- 19156
- spent
- true